## CI Note: keyspin rotation utility failing in pipeline

The keyspin secrets-rotation utility fails on the Harrowgate CI runners with a vault timeout. Cause: runners pull the stale utility image after cache eviction. Fix: force a fresh pull in the pre-step, then rerun. Do not rotate manually; keyspin tracks rotation state and a manual run desyncs it. Confirm the runner pulled the correct image — the expected build token is below.

trace token, fafog-kageg: htk4_98e6

**Q: Why does the TideGlass widget show stale predictions?**

TideGlass caches harmonic data per station for 24 hours. If the Saltmere feed publishes a correction mid-cycle, the widget lags until cache expiry. Don't flush caches manually in prod — it hammers the feed. Corrections are rare; stale data usually means a failed fetch job instead. Cache layout and the fetch job schedule are documented on the internal page.

runbook for tafof-yawif: https://confluence.tolvaqsys.internal/display/display/browse/pages/7be3

Hi plugin authors — during next week's disaster-recovery drill, Quillhaven will freeze canary promotions: no plugin build advances past 5% traffic unless error rates stay under the gating threshold for two full windows. If your canary stalls, don't retry manually. To re-enable promotion after the drill, our recovery tooling will prompt you for the phrase below.

vault phrase of yagag-kadup = belael-druius-rusax-kelox

- [ ] Step 7: Archive cold storage buckets (Glacierline tier). Confirm both ceremony witnesses are present, verify bucket manifests match the Oxbow ledger, then seal the archive key shares. Plugin authors may observe but not handle shares. Once sealed, the archive index itself is encrypted and can only be reopened with the passphrase below.

vault phrase of badup-hahig = tamael-aldael-kelmir-istael-fenok-istwyn-tamius-jorath-oliion